Why licensing matters more in healthcare ERP evaluation
Healthcare ERP environments typically involve finance teams, procurement, inventory managers, facilities operations, HR, revenue cycle support, compliance officers, executives, and external service providers. In many cases, organizations also need controlled access for satellite clinics, outsourced billing teams, pharmacy operations, or affiliated entities. When every additional user triggers incremental licensing cost, organizations often restrict access, share credentials, delay workflow digitization, or keep critical processes outside the ERP. Those decisions increase governance risk and reduce the value of the platform.
From a partner perspective, licensing also shapes the commercial model. A healthcare ERP reseller or managed platform provider needs predictable economics to build recurring revenue, support compliance operations, and package white-label services. If the vendor licensing model is highly variable, margins become harder to forecast and customer retention can weaken when annual true-ups create budget surprises.

Governance and compliance tradeoffs in healthcare ERP licensing
Healthcare ERP governance is not limited to security settings. It includes role design, approval controls, audit trails, segregation of duties, data retention, vendor management, financial controls, and operational resilience. Licensing affects each of these areas because governance requires broad but controlled participation. Compliance teams need visibility. Department managers need approval access. External auditors may need temporary review rights. Acquired entities may need staged onboarding. A restrictive licensing model can undermine governance by making proper access design financially unattractive.
This is where cloud ERP comparison should move beyond headline subscription pricing. Buyers and partners should assess whether the platform supports policy-based administration, centralized identity controls, environment separation, logging, workflow traceability, and integration governance. A lower-cost license is not lower risk if it pushes organizations into manual controls, spreadsheet-based approvals, or disconnected reporting.

Long-term cost exposure: subscription price is only one variable
Healthcare ERP evaluation often underestimates long-term cost exposure because procurement teams focus on year-one software fees. In practice, cost expands through user growth, compliance administration, integration maintenance, reporting complexity, environment management, support overhead, and vendor-driven licensing changes. Per-user models can become especially expensive in healthcare because organizations add users not only for growth but also for governance maturity. Better controls often require more participants, not fewer.
A more realistic TCO model should include software subscription, implementation, migration, integration, training, support, compliance operations, reporting administration, and annual change management. For partners, it should also include margin durability, support burden, and the ability to convert one-time implementation work into managed recurring revenue. Platforms that support unlimited users, cloud-native operations, and white-label managed services often create stronger long-term economics even when initial subscription pricing appears higher.
Realistic evaluation scenarios for healthcare buyers and partners
Scenario one involves a regional clinic network with 18 locations replacing a legacy finance and procurement stack. The organization initially estimates 140 ERP users, but after governance review it identifies another 90 users across compliance, local operations, inventory control, and executive reporting. Under a per-user model, the business either absorbs a significant budget increase or limits access. Under an unlimited-user model, it can extend role-based access without renegotiating the commercial baseline. For the partner, this creates a better path to managed administration, reporting services, and ongoing optimization.
Scenario two involves a healthcare services group acquiring two specialty practices each year. In a per-user environment, every acquisition triggers licensing analysis, seat expansion, and budget revision. In an unlimited-user cloud ERP model, the focus shifts from seat counting to governance standardization, data migration, and workflow harmonization. That is strategically better for both the customer and the partner because value is created through operational integration rather than licensing administration.

Ecosystem maturity, implementation considerations, and migration risk
Licensing strength alone does not make a platform viable. Healthcare organizations and partners should evaluate ecosystem maturity, implementation tooling, migration pathways, support responsiveness, and governance frameworks. A cloud ERP comparison should examine whether the vendor or platform ecosystem supports repeatable deployment patterns, healthcare-relevant controls, API maturity, data migration utilities, and post-go-live operational services.
Migration considerations are especially important where legacy systems contain fragmented supplier data, inconsistent chart-of-accounts structures, or disconnected approval workflows. A platform with attractive licensing but weak migration support can increase project risk and delay value realization. Partners should prioritize platforms that reduce implementation complexity, support phased modernization, and allow governance controls to be established early rather than retrofitted after go-live.
